Job Summary:
The Developmental Specialist provides direct care and case management services for a group of assigned clients. This is a non-exempt position. 
 

Supervisory Responsibilities: None. 
 

Essential Functions of Position:

  • Participates in the development and implementation of Day Habilitation Service Plans, IDT, goals, and activities for assigned caseload.  In collaboration with program participants, helps them to identify and develop plans, goals and objectives that are measurable and tailored to their individual strengths, needs and interests. 
  • Teaches developmental skills to increase independent functioning including self-care, self-preservation, receptive and expressive communication, self- advocacy, self-direction, and activities of daily living, (ADL’s including personal hygiene & grooming, first aid and meal selection and preparation).
  • Leads group in planning and implementing training and therapeutic activities that support Service Plan goals. Provides direction to direct care staff to ensure that the program participants’ needs are met and that activity requirements are fulfilled according to program schedule. Provide client coverage for other groups and activities as assigned.
  • Provides required documentation for participant activities for each day. Assesses progress made on Service Plan objectives and document in progress notes completed by the fifteenth day of the following month.
  • Provides supportive counseling to participants around daily personal and social issues.
  • Delivers services to program participants with respect and dignity in accordance with human rights training, DDS regulations for human rights, and Bay Cove standards.
  • Reports medical and health concerns to the Healthcare Supervisor. Provides emergency intervention as needed. Provide emergency interventions and physical assistance to program participants whenever it is needed.
  • Other duties as assigned by the Program Director.
